What is China Tower Long-Term Debt?

China Tower CTOWY 68 Long-Term Debt is $5,115 Mil as of Dec. 2025. GuruFocus rates CTOWY with a GF Score™ of 68/100 and a GF Value™ of $18.16 (Modestly Undervalued). The stock has 4 warning signs investors should review.

China Tower's Long-Term Debt for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2025 was $5,115 Mil.

China Tower's quarterly Long-Term Debt declined from Dec. 2024 ($5,643 Mil) to Jun. 2025 ($3,465 Mil) but then increased from Jun. 2025 ($3,465 Mil) to Dec. 2025 ($5,115 Mil).

China Tower's annual Long-Term Debt declined from Dec. 2023 ($6,915 Mil) to Dec. 2024 ($5,643 Mil) and declined from Dec. 2024 ($5,643 Mil) to Dec. 2025 ($5,115 Mil).


China Tower  (OTCPK:CTOWY) Long-Term Debt Explanation

Long-Term Debt is the sum of the carrying values as of the balance sheet date of all long-term debt, which is debt initially having maturities due after one year or beyond the operating cycle, if longer, but excluding the portions thereof scheduled to be repaid within one year or the normal operating cycle, if longer. Long-Term Debt includes notes payable, bonds payable, mortgage loans, convertible debt, subordinated debt and other types of long term debt.

China Tower Business Description

Address Yard No. 9, Dongran North Street, Room 101, LG1 to 3rd Floor, Building 14, North District, Haidian District, Beijing, CHN
China Tower Corp Ltd is a telecommunications tower infrastructure service provider. It is principally engaged in the construction, maintenance, and operation of base station ancillary facilities such as telecommunications towers, public network coverage in high-speed railways and subways, and large-scale indoor Distributed Antenna Systems (DAS). The Group's various operating divisions are Tower business, DAS business, Smart Tower business, and Energy business. Geographically, the Group derives all of its revenue from Mainland China.
